2022 USA Shooting Junior Olympic Nebraska State Qualifier

Announcing the 2022 USA Shooting Junior Olympic Nebraska state qualifier shoot to be held at Heartland Public Shooting Park in Grand Island May 28-29.

Events consist of 125 International Skeet targets on Saturday May 28th and 125 International (Bunker) Trap targets on Sunday May 29th with a potential Finals shoot-off at the conclusion of each event.

 Athletes born in 2002 or later are eligible for entry.

For 2022, there has been a change to the Cut-Off scores for an invitation to the National Junior Olympic (JO) match – Trap and Skeet both will not have a Cut-Off score and the National JO match will be open until filled. This change due to being hosted at a larger venue that can accommodate more competitors this year.

The cost is $80.00 per event. For this event, please pay with either cash or check. Payment is due at the time of registration.

Ammunition: 24-gram loads are preferred but 1 oz. loads are acceptable for this competition only. The purchase of ammunition will be available at the clubhouse or by calling Steve Loschen (308)-991-5850. Please indicate what ammunition is needed during or before registration. The price of one flat of shells (10 boxes) is $115 AA Winchester #9 24 gram and $90 for Fiocchi #7.5 1 oz. Steve Loschen may have official Bunker Trap target loads, but you must contact him to confirm availability.
